3 Major Trends Transforming the Logistics Industry You Can’t Ignore

With the increased connections among different countries in the modern world, the demand for different goods and products has increased, including logistics of edibles, vegetables, medicines, and the spare parts of vehicles and military equipment. Investors and business owners from all over the world rely on freight forwarders and supply chain managers to move their products to different parts of the world. Freight forwarders manage, coordinate and conduct the shipping of goods from one place to another by sea, air, road, or rail. From the confirmation of an order to its fulfillment, all can be handled by the logistics management teams. Logistics and freight forwarding companies provide multiple services that include warehousing, transportation, storage facilities, etc. They also give guidelines to their customers for preparing the shipment documents which may comprise an ocean freight quote, a detailed information of the shipping policies and area-specific shipping price of freights. They also make sure that the products reach their customers smoothly and on time regardless of the geographical constraints, including bad weather or poor infrastructure.

#1. Role of AI and Augmented Intelligence

With AI spring in action, logistics companies are looking for ways to digitize themselves to solve various problems digitally which in turn would help them to increase their operational efficiency. It’s about time that companies integrate AI as those abstaining from it, might not succeed. With the advanced codes and algorithms, AI is capable of

  • Handling larger amounts of data
  • Lowering the cost
  • Working efficiently in high volumes and low margins
  • Performing multiple payments
  • Meeting shorter deadlines

AI can assist logistics companies in handling customer’s demands with efficient techniques because that’s what people today expect and ask for.

Customer Service

With advancements in technology, the fulfillment of customer’s demands also requires technological usage. Moreover, as the company grows, the number of customers also increases and, in such cases, it can become difficult to cater to their needs and keep them all satisfied at the same time. But there’s no need to worry as the AI, with the ability to comprehend and communicate in various languages can address many of their demands. The automated voice bots and chat-bots can help companies to communicate and interact with the customers’ concerns in multiple languages.

Cognitive Contracts

AI can also help in classifying the provisions and conditions of an agreement. It also backs up data to keep the record related to contracts safe. Because of this amazing feature, it can assist people in identifying different parts of the contracts that could consist of hundreds of pages quickly. Among those pages, the important parts, including the signatures and the agreed policies can be reviewed by AI in a shorter time. It can analyze all the information with speed and efficiency. These cognitive contracts cut any chances of mistakes and keep the process transparent.

Predictive Logistics

AI can also make articulation regarding the demand and supply of products. Thus, it saves time and money. Furthermore, with the latest technology of AI, companies no longer have to depend upon defensive mechanism to handle unexpected situations. Now, AI is assisting organizations to operate on predictive mechanisms. In which proactive measures are worked upon to prevent any unwanted situation.

#2. Warehouse Robotics and Autonomous Vehicles 

Inventory tracking, warehousing, and transportation of goods are the most important pillars of the whole logistics system. As the business expands, and the network grows, the number of customers increases. To cater to the rising challenges, new ideas regarding the automation of vehicles and warehouses can be worked upon. These should mainly aim at reducing the chances of error and saving time, fuel and cost of labour.

Customized Warehousing

In modern times, the role of the warehouse has surpassed its traditional role of just being a storage place. The warehouses have evolved owing to the modern-day growing demands. Many companies are looking for ways to customize their warehouses and to double the speed of

  • Picking
  • Kitting
  • Assembling
  • Storing
  • Packaging

Customized warehouses add speed to deliveries and ease various operations with the help of warehouse robots, bar-code labels, at a reduced cost. With AI, automation in warehouses has made the handling of huge volumes of products easier.

Intelligent Robotics Sorting:

This technology helps to assort and arrange letters and parcels. Logistics companies have to deal with millions of letters, parcels and shipments daily. Robotic sorting can help in the categorization of these things in a short time, saving effort and cost.

There are robots that assist humans in storing and packaging goods too, thus increasing the efficiency of the process.

Customized Vehicles

The customization of vehicles is a new trend in the modern supply chain. With the customization of vehicles, the transportation of medicines and other temperature-sensitive products has become safer. Moving such products is a very responsible task and any error in this job can have severe consequences. Customized vehicles can allow:

  • Easy loading and unloading of the products
  • Autonomous operations
  • Controlling temperature within the labeled range with the help of refrigerated vehicle
  • Preventing products from exposure to high and low temperatures with temperature controlled vehicles
  • Using alternative fuels to have eco-friendly transportation

With automation, vehicles can analyze and predict traffic and can communicate with other automated machines. They can also re-route the fleet if there is any hurdle in the already planned route.

IoT, RFID, WMS SOFTWARE

IoT short for ‘Internet of Things, with the help of its sensors, technology, and networking can streamline the whole logistics process. It can help share the supply chain information without requiring human contact. It can take care of the following things:

  • Supply chain monitoring
  • Vehicle tracking
  • Inventory management
  • Transportation safety
  • Automation of warehouses and vehicles
  • Delivery status

RFID uses wireless signals to share data between different microchips that are inserted in tags, cards, and labels of the products. This reduces the chances of error and increases reliability. RFID can provide many details, including:

  • Size and type of product
  • Quality
  • Country of origin
  • Country of manufacturing
  • Analysis of the sale patterns
  • Time of sale of products

WMS Software optimizes all the warehouse operations. Warehouse management software can monitor all inventory-related jobs. In this way, it can:

  • Minimize labor expenses
  • Enhance customer experience
  • Increase the accuracy of product-related information hence improving transparency
  • Enhance the responsiveness
  • Manage inventory with information of the latest order and shipment
  • Make effective use of space in a warehouse

#3. BlockChain and Logistics

Blockchains having decentralized data structures can help in overcoming a lot of loopholes in logistics management. The data in blockchains is owned by everyone and any changes made in it are visible to all the people involved. The principles that blockchain relies upon are:

  • Transparency
  • Decentralized data structure
  • Immutability

With such technology, firms can handle a large business easily by keeping the whole logistics process transparent. It not only keeps an eye on the physical flow of products but also on the flow of finances and information throughout the supply chain. It helps to carefully observe third-party agents, inventory, transportation, payments and assists in keeping the record of an agreement safe.

Transparency

Mishandling of data is one of the major issues of supply chain and logistics management. Blockchain, having immutability features, allows all the parties to access data. It helps to prevent any loss or meddling of information. Having the ability to handle larger volumes of data, makes the whole process error-free and transparent. It can help spot any financial anomaly in billing, invoices, and payments and takes care of all the critical data thus, reducing the chances of counterfeiting to zero.  

Real-time Visibility

Every step in the supply chain can be recorded by blockchain and the data and information are shared with all the people involved. This makes the whole process visible. Moreover, the information is accessible from any part of the world.

Efficient and Timely Delivery

Customers prefer speedy and efficient ways for their daily activities. With the help of blockchains, smart contracts and online payments, the speed, accuracy and transparency increase. Sharing the information regarding the status of the product makes the payment and delivery process efficient.
